I have 2 convicts in one tank and one of them has this reddish dusty
rust
colour to his sides... Now he has had it for quite a while and I was
wondering if this is anything I should be worried about?

Thanks.


Female convicts have this red coloring on the sides.


Yes that is the female. They do that when ready to breed. And keeps a rosy
belly to help the fry identify her. If she has fry leave her with them, as
she is a very good parent. The male will also guard the fry and is very
aggressive when with fry. Mine had about 20 fry survive and doing well.
Give them a hidden rocky area and they will be happy.
